Again you have unearthed instances where personal orders have been given (presented) after the death of the head of the order. I suspect it highlights the importance attached to being able to wear orders and badges in a hierarchical society where every nuance of rank was upheld, and scrutinised by others.
I am intrigued at how Queen Ena's second class badge has been changed to having a border of pearls rather than diamonds. I doubt if Queen Ena was ever in such dire need that she stripped small (and possibility low quality) diamonds from an order to pay her bills, as the sale of an intact item would render it more valuable. The sale of large items (well documented) is understandable, but to strip a badge of small diamonds, thereby decreasing its value, seems illogical.
